Provincial Assembly

Composition

  • Provincial Assemblies consist of members representing each region of the special metropolitan city, metropolitan cities, cities, provinces and special self-governing provinces of South Korea, 5 North Korean provinces, and overseas areas.
    • Domestic : 17 cities and provinces, 5 North Korean provinces
    • Overseas : Americas, Japan, China, Asia-Pacific, Europe·Middle East·Africa
  • The Chairperson appoints a vice chairperson to represent the Provincial Assemblies and supervise their administrative affairs.

Functions

  • Advise and propose peaceful unification policies through the provincial assemblies
  • Form and gather regional opinions on a peaceful unification
  • Deepen and broaden the regional support basis for a peaceful unification
  • Perform other essential regional activities to lay the groundwork for reunification

Projects

  • Article 2 of the Managerial Regulations of Domestic Provincial Assembly
    • Establishing and implementing a detailed plan to convene the provincial assemblies
    • Conducting surveys and research for unification policy advice and proposals
    • Promoting regional discussions on reunification and implementing programs to gather regional opinions
    • Supporting and promoting activities and projects of youth and women council members
    • Implementing unification education to foster the future generation of a united-Korea
    • Carrying out unification culture projects to lay the groundwork for unification
    • Facilitating inter-Korean exchanges and cooperation projects
    • Implementing other projects aligned with the objectives of provincial assemblies
  • Article 3 of the Managerial Regulations of Overseas Provincial Assembly
    • Establishing and implementing a detailed plan to convene the overseas provincial assemblies
    • Conducting surveys and research for unification policy advice and proposals
    • Promoting discussions on reunification across overseas Korean communities and gathering regional opinions
    • Supporting the activities of youth and women council members
    • Raising the unification awareness of overseas Korean teenagers
    • Laying the groundwork for reunification through overseas Korean communities
    • Implementing other projects aligned with the objectives of provincial assemblies

Conferences of Provincial Assembly

  • The provincial assemblies are convened once every two years, in the year when the General Assembly is not held, by each city and province of South Korea.
    • The conferences are presided over by the respective vice chairperson for each city and province with all council members in attendance according to their representation.
    • Overseas provincial assembly convene their conferences on invitation to Korea.

Municipal Chapter

Composition

  • Municipal Chapter are established for each city, county and district of South Korea and composed of council members residing in each community.
    • Domestic : 228 municipal chapters, Overseas : 45 municipal chapters (131 nations)
  • The Chairperson appoints the head of each municipal chapter to represent each body and supervise overall administrative affairs.

Functions

  • Gather community opinions on a peaceful unification
  • Promote community discussions on a peaceful unification
  • Lead local residents to reach agreements on a peaceful unification
  • Other community activities required to lay the groundwork for unification

Major Projects of Domestic Municipal Chapter

  • Gathering community opinions on a peaceful unification
  • Sharing understanding of unification policies throughout communities
  • Promoting intra- and inter-community discussions on reunification
  • Raising unification awareness to foster the future generation for a united-Korea
  • Uniting the resolution and capabilities of local residents for reunification through unification culture projects
  • Facilitating inter-Korean interactions and cooperation
  • Contributing to community reconciliation and development
  • Implementing other projects aligned with the objectives of municipal Chapter

Major Projects of Overseas Municipal Chapter

  • Gathering opinions of overseas Korean communities on a peaceful unification
  • Sharing understanding of unification policies throughout communities and enhancing the support basis of the international community
  • Raising unification recognition of overseas Korean teenagers
  • Laying the groundwork for reunification through overseas Korean communities
  • Promoting overseas Koreans' reconciliation and amicable relations within the community and with the societies in which they live
  • Implementing other projects aligned with the objectives of municipal Chapter
The Peaceful Unification Advisory Council serves as the central mechanism of the reunification movement to promote communication with and reconciliation between the people and implements multi-faceted activities, including advising the President on unification policy, to spread understanding and unite the nation's determination and capabilities for reunification.
